Introduction
Internet of Things (IoT) is a technology that has revolutionized the way we interact with everyday objects. From smart homes to wearable devices, IoT has become an integral part of our daily lives. In this blog post, we will provide a comprehensive guide on programming for the Internet of Things.
Getting Started with IoT Programming
Before diving into programming for IoT, it is important to understand the basic concepts and components of IoT. IoT devices are typically made up of sensors, actuators, and microcontrollers. These devices communicate with each other through the internet, collecting and exchanging data to automate processes and enhance efficiency.
Choosing the Right Programming Language
When it comes to programming for IoT, there are several programming languages to choose from. Some of the most popular languages for IoT development include C, C++, Python, and Java. The choice of programming language will depend on the specific requirements of your IoT project.
Programming for IoT Applications
Once you have chosen a programming language, it is time to start developing applications for IoT. Whether you are building a smart home system or a wearable device, programming for IoT requires a deep understanding of sensors, data processing, and network communication. It is important to test your applications thoroughly to ensure they function properly in a real-world environment.
Conclusion
Programming for the Internet of Things is an exciting field that offers endless opportunities for innovation. By following the guidelines outlined in this blog post, you can develop robust and reliable applications for IoT. We hope this guide has been helpful in getting you started on your IoT programming journey. Feel free to leave a comment below with any questions or feedback.